'Look Here' Awe Walk and Viewfinder Accessory - Clerkenwell Design Week 2026
For Clerkenwell Design Week 2026, Louisa Tan (Common Exception) and I launched the Viewfinder Accessory, a dual-purpose wearable design object, part viewfinder, part accessory, alongside two special edition Awe Walks titled 'Look Here'.
Louisa and I created Awe Walks to invite people to look more closely at the world around them, discovering tiny moments of awe hiding in plain sight. For previous walks, we had been hand-cutting simple viewfinders from leftover coloured card to frame small details along the way. People asked us if they could keep the viewfinders to continue looking for awe in their everyday lives, so we came up with a more permanent solution, one that didn’t disintegrate in the rain!
Working with sustainable surfaces manufacturer Smile Materials, we developed the Viewfinder Accessory from 100% recycled plastic off-cuts, something that could be worn on the wrist or as a bag pendant, and used long after the walk is over. It felt very much in line with our ethos: appreciating small moments of wonder while creating something with longevity and purpose, without generating waste.
Unveiled for the first time at Clerkenwell Design Week, our 'Look Here' Awe Walks guided participants through the neighbourhood using the Viewfinder to frame moments of colour, pattern, texture, and to wear it afterwards as a reminder to keep looking closely for the joy in the world around them.
